Preamp and Upper Analog Cards

A Preamp card (SPR card) contains preamplifier, motor, and write driver circuitry.

The Upper Analog card (SUA card in the EXB-8505 and EXB-8505XL; VUA card in the EXB-8205 and EXB-8205XL) contains analog filters, equalization, and clock-detect circuitry.

Together, the preamp and upper analog cards comprise the write and read electronics. The write electronics consist of write control circuits for digital data and servo information, as well as the write head driver circuits. The read electronics consist of preamplifiers and equalization circuits for the read channels, the servo channel, amplitude sensing, and data clocking and detection.

Lower Digital (SLD) Card

The Lower Digital (SLD) card contains the data processor, error correction code, buffer memory, and control circuitry. The tape drive’s data buffer includes 1 MByte of dynamic random access memory (DRAM).

The SLD card controls communication between the tape drive and the SCSI bus, and can be either of the following:

SLDS (single-ended SCSI)

SLDD (differential SCSI)

The SLD card contains a 8051-compatible microprocessor, which implements the controller function. The controller function includes the following activities:

Data compression SCSI bus management

SCSI command decode and status presentation Scheduling of all tape drive operations Motion control management

Data transfer and buffer management Logical-to-physical block packing and unpacking Tape formatting; header and search field generation Read-after-write verification and rewrite management Tape drive statistics and sense data

Error recovery procedures Monitor interface
